区块链钱包开发对接:行业新动向与技术剖析
区块链技术作为近年来最为火热的科技创新之一,持续吸引了大量创业者和投资者的关注。在这个背景下,区块链钱包作为一个重要的工具,承载着加密资产的存储与交易功能,显得尤为重要。随着区块链应用的不断扩展,如何开发与对接区块链钱包,成为了业界讨论的重点。
### 区块链钱包的基本概念
区块链钱包是用于存储和管理加密货币的一种数字钱包。它不仅可以用来接收、发送加密资产,还是用户控制其私钥的工具。用户通过钱包能够与区块链网络进行交互。钱包的种类主要分为热钱包和冷钱包,前者连接互联网,适合日常交易;后者离线存储,安全性更高。
#### 热钱包与冷钱包的不同
热钱包内部集成了区块链的基本协议,便于用户快速完成交易,但同时也面临着更多的安全风险;冷钱包则提供了自动备份与保管功能,但使用较为不便。根据实际需要,用户可以选择不同类型的钱包。
### 现阶段区块链钱包对接的行业动态
近年来,随着DeFi(去中心化金融)、NFT(非同质化代币)等新兴领域的兴起,区块链钱包的开发对接愈发复杂。开发者需要支持多种加密资产以及跨链交易功能,以满足市场的需求。此外,用户的安全、隐私保护等问题也引起了广泛关注。
#### 对接技术的进步
从技术层面来看,区块链钱包的开发对接逐渐向标准化、模块化方向发展。使用API、SDK等工具,可以大大提高开发效率。在一些框架中,开发者能够快速构建钱包功能,并且更加方便地进行与第三方平台的对接。
### 如何进行区块链钱包开发
#### 需求分析
在开发任何软件之前,需求分析是第一步。需要弄清楚目标用户是谁,他们的使用场景、功能需求、使用习惯等。此外,随着不同区块链技术的出现,最好能够选择一种适合自身需求的区块链平台。
#### 选择合适的开发框架
目前市场上有许多现成的区块链开发框架,如Ethereum、Hyperledger、NEO等。根据项目需求,选择一款合适的框架是关键。
#### 用户界面设计
用户界面的设计应便捷易用,尽量降低操作复杂度。良好的用户体验能够提升用户的使用积极性,增加钱包的用户黏性。
#### 钱包安全性
安全性是区块链钱包开发中最重要的考虑因素之一。开发者需要采取多种安全措施,如冷热钱包结合、私钥管理、身份验证等,以最大限度地保护用户资产。
#### 上线前的测试
在正式上线之前,对钱包进行充分的测试是必不可少的步骤。包括功能测试、性能测试、安全测试等。确保钱包在实际使用中,能够高效稳定地运行。
### 可能相关问题解析
#### 区块链钱包开发的技术挑战有哪些?
**技术挑战概述**
区块链钱包的开发并非易事,面临着多方面的技术挑战。首先,不同区块链有各自的协议和标准,开发者需要在这些差异中找到一个适合的解决方案。此外,随着技术的发展,如何保持钱包的功能新颖而又适应用户需求,也成为了一个重要的挑战。
**挑战一:安全性与私钥管理**
安全性是区块链钱包开发中的重中之重。如果钱包被黑客攻击,用户的资产将面临巨大风险。因此,开发者必须设计出安全的存储方案,比如将私钥加密存储,或采用分布式存储方式。此外,如何进行安全审核也是一大挑战,需开发团队制定安全规范。
**挑战二:用户体验与技术融合**
用户体验也是另一个重要的挑战。虽然区块链技术为用户提供了新的可能性,但复杂的操作和不友好的界面往往让普通用户感到困惑。如何将区块链技术与良好的用户体验结合,是开发过程中必须考虑的问题。
**挑战三:合规性问题**
随着区块链行业的快速发展,各国对加密资产及相关软件的监管政策也在不断变化。开发者需关注最新的法律法规,以确保钱包的合规性。
综上所述,区块链钱包开发中的技术挑战包括但不限于安全性、用户体验和合规性等。
#### 如何选择适合的区块链平台?
**平台选择的重要性**
在进行区块链钱包开发之前,选择一个成熟且合适的区块链平台至关重要。这将直接影响钱包的性能、功能以及后续的维护工作。
**平台选择的标准**
选择区块链平台时,应考虑以下几个标准:
1. **技术成熟度**:优先选择那些经过时间考验的区块链平台,如Bitcoin、Ethereum等,这些平台相对稳定,生态完善。
2. **社区支持**:一个活跃的开发社区意味着有丰富的资源和支持,便于开发者解决问题。
3. **可扩展性**:在选择平台时,考虑其可扩展性非常重要,主要针对后续可能的业务增长与技术需求。
4. **安全机制**:不同平台的安全机制、共识机制等存在差异,需选择那些具有高度安全性的平台。
5. **开发工具和文档**:合适的开发工具和完备的文档能为开发过程提供帮助,降低研发成本。
通过以上标准,开发者能够更为科学地选择适合的区块链平台。
#### 区块链钱包的商业模式是什么?
**商业模式概述**
区块链钱包的商业模式多种多样,开发者需要根据市场需求选择合适的盈利模式。
**模式一:交易费用**
一种普遍的商业模式是通过收取交易手续费来盈利。每当用户利用钱包进行交易时,可以对其收取一定比例的手续费。
**模式二:增值服务**
除了基本的钱包功能外,开发者还可以提供一些增值服务,如投资咨询、资产管理等。这些服务通常收费,能为开发者带来额外收益。
**模式三:数据分析**
通过钱包积累的大量用户数据,可进行趋势分析和市场研究。这部分数据若能合理利用,可以为其他企业提供价值。
**模式四:合作分成**
与其他金融服务提供商合作,共同开发产品或推广活动,双方可以通过客户获取、交易分成等方式获得收益。
综上所述,区块链钱包的商业模式多样,需根据市场环境和用户需求不断调整。
#### 区块链钱包的未来发展趋势是什么?
**发展趋势概述**
随着技术的快速发展和市场的不断变化,区块链钱包的未来趋势值得关注。
**趋势一:多币种支持**
未来的钱包将越来越倾向于支持多种加密货币和资产,包括法币和数字货币。这种多样性将使用户能够更方便地管理自己的资产。
**趋势二:集成更多金融服务**
区块链钱包不仅仅是存储工具,它将集成更多的金融服务,比如贷款、保险、支付等,为用户提供更全面的金融服务体验。
**趋势三:跨链交易功能**
跨链技术的发展将使不同区块链之间的资产转移更为方便。未来的钱包可能将实现无需中心化交易所即可完成的跨链交易。
**趋势四:用户隐私保护**
随着用户对隐私问题的关注增加,各大钱包开发团队也将越来越重视隐私保护技术的发展,可能会采用零知识证明等技术实现信息的隐私保护。
总的来说,区块链钱包开发对接的未来发展值得期待,技术将带来更多机会与可能性。